Expert View: Beyond Pressing – Other Tactical Shifts

This is where the real tactical masterclasses come into play, and oh boy, is there controversy! For years, controlling the tempo with possession was seen as the ultimate achievement. Now, teams like Liverpool under Klopp or Napoli have shown the incredible power of relentless pressing. But is it sustainable? Critics point to the physical toll and the potential for opponents to exploit the spaces left behind. On the other hand, traditionalists lament the loss of beautiful, intricate passing sequences. It’s a fascinating clash of philosophies that directly impacts how we analyze games, whether it's an iconic derby game or a crucial Europa League knockout stage match.

"The modern footballer needs to be incredibly versatile. Gone are the days of simply being a 'defender' or 'midfielder.' Players are expected to understand multiple roles and adapt to fluid tactical systems. This adaptability is the new frontier."
  • Goalkeepers are increasingly involved in build-up play, acting as an extra outfield player.
  • The tactical role of wing-backs and full-backs has become more complex and demanding.
  • Data analytics are providing coaches with deeper insights into opponent weaknesses and tactical adjustments.

It's not just about pressing, though, is it? We're seeing other fascinating shifts. The way teams build from the back has evolved dramatically, with goalkeepers becoming integral playmakers. The use of inverted full-backs, the rise of false nines – these aren't just buzzwords; they're tactical innovations that are changing the game's landscape.
